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of modular house frame welding positioning device, specifically, to a modular house frame welding positioning device. Background Technology

[0002] Modular housing involves breaking down a house into different functional modules, manufacturing them in factories using standardized, modular, and universal production methods. The houses can be assembled on-site anytime, anywhere, with the entire process taking only a few hours. Modular integrated construction completely overturns the traditional, non-recyclable model of house construction. It can be simple or retro, habitable, entertaining, or used for special purposes. It is easy to transport, install, dismantle, and reuse.

[0003] Modular houses require the assembly of multiple frames. During the production of the frames, welding is required. To ensure welding quality, it is necessary to ensure the stable positioning of the frames during welding. Frames are generally large in size, and traditional positioning methods are complex in structure and time-consuming and labor-intensive. Existing technologies have not adequately solved these problems, causing difficulties for the normal operation of this field. Therefore, there is an urgent need for a modular house frame welding positioning device to solve the above problems. Utility Model Content

[0013] The working principle and beneficial effects of this utility model are as follows:

[0014] The frame, as the main component bearing the overall weight, has a side frame on each side. The space between the frame and the two side frames is used to accommodate the frame itself. A counterweight plate is swung at the top of each side frame. This counterweight plate, with its own weight, applies a stable clamping force to the frame after the frame is transported between the two side frames. Multiple counterweight plates are installed on each side frame, allowing for the simultaneous positioning of multiple frames.

[0015] In addition, an auxiliary telescopic cylinder and auxiliary rollers were added. The auxiliary telescopic cylinder is mounted on the side frame, and the auxiliary rollers are rotatably mounted on the telescopic end of the cylinder. A groove is cut along the length of the counterweight rod on its side, and the auxiliary rollers are located within the groove. When the counterweight rod swings, the auxiliary rollers roll within the groove. When the weight of the counterweight rod itself is insufficient to apply a stable clamping force to the frame, the telescopic cylinder can be controlled to shorten its telescopic end. The rollers, in contact with the side wall of the groove, apply a downward swinging force to the counterweight rod, thereby increasing the clamping force and ensuring stable clamping of the frame. Because the counterweight rod is quite heavy, manually lifting it after welding is difficult. In this case, the auxiliary telescopic cylinder can be extended, and the rollers apply an upward force to the side wall of the groove, helping to lift the counterweight rod and making its operation easier for workers. [0026] Reference Figures 1-4This is the first embodiment of the present invention, which proposes a modular house frame welding positioning device, including a frame 1, a side frame 2, a counterweight plate 3, an au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4, and an auxiliary roller 5. The side frame 2 is mounted on the frame 1. The counterweight plate 3 is oscillatingly mounted on the side frame 2. There are multiple counterweight plates 3. After oscillating, the counterweight plate 3 is used to press and position the workpiece. The au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 is mounted on the side frame 2. The au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 has a telescopic end. The auxiliary roller 5 is rotatably mounted on the telescopic end of the au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4. The counterweight plate 3 has a groove 6 along its length, and the auxiliary roller 5 is located in the groove 6.

[0027] In this embodiment, the frame 1 serves as the main component bearing the overall weight. A side frame 2 is installed on each side of the frame 1, and the space between the frame 1 and the two side frames 2 is used to accommodate the frame. A counterweight plate 3 is swung at the top of the side frame 2. The counterweight plate 3 has a certain weight; after the frame is transported between the two side frames 2, the counterweight plate 3 is swung downwards to abut against the frame. The counterweight plate 3 itself has a certain weight, and its weight applies a stable clamping force to the frame, thereby ensuring the stability of the frame and facilitating welding operations. Multiple counterweight plates 3 are installed on each of the two side frames 2, allowing for the simultaneous positioning of multiple frames.

[0028] In addition, an au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 and an auxiliary roller 5 were added. The au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 is mounted on the side frame 2, and the auxiliary roller 5 is rotatably mounted on the telescopic end of the au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4. A groove 6 is formed along the length of the counterweight rod on its side, and the auxiliary roller 5 is located in the groove 6. When the counterweight rod swings, the auxiliary roller 5 rolls in the groove 6. When the weight of the counterweight rod itself is insufficient to apply a stable clamping force to the frame, the telescopic cylinder 4 can be controlled to shorten its telescopic end. By using the contact relationship between the roller and the side wall of the groove 6, a downward swinging force is applied to the counterweight rod, thereby increasing the clamping force and ensuring the stable clamping of the frame. Because the counterweight rod has a large weight, it is difficult to lift the counterweight rod manually after welding. At this time, the au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 can be extended, and the roller can apply an upward force to the side wall of the groove 6, thereby helping to lift the counterweight rod and making the operation of the counterweight rod easier for the workers.

[0029] It also includes a conical pressure head 7, which is located at the end of the counterweight plate 3 and is used to engage with a pre-made process hole on the workpiece.

[0030] In this embodiment, to facilitate the positioning of the frame, process holes are pre-drilled on the frame, and a conical pressure head 7 is provided at the end of the counterweight pressure plate 3. When the frame is tightened, the conical pressure head 7 can abut into the process holes on the frame, which helps to align the tightening position of the counterweight pressure rod and increases the firmness between the counterweight pressure rod and the frame. The end of the conical pressure head 7 is designed in a conical shape to serve as a guide, making it easier to enter the process holes during tightening.

[0031] The side frame 2 is slidably mounted on the frame 1. There are two side frames 2, and the two side frames 2 slide synchronously and in opposite directions.

[0032] In this embodiment, the side frame 2 can slide on the frame 1 to adapt to frames of different widths. The side frame 2 can improve positioning stability by abutting against the side of the frame. A bidirectional screw can also be rotatably mounted on the frame 1. The bidirectional screw has two sections of threads with opposite directions and the same pitch. The two side frames 2 are threaded onto the two sections of threads respectively. A motor and a reducer can be mounted on the frame 1 to drive the rotation of the bidirectional screw. The two side frames 2 slide synchronously in opposite directions through the bidirectional screw. When placing the frame between the two side frames 2, the two side frames 2 can be slid outwards to make way for the frame and facilitate its entry. During positioning, the two side frames 2 can be slid inwards to abut against the side of the frame to improve positioning stability.

[0033] It also includes a guide plate 8, which is disposed on the side frame 2. The guide plate 8 has a guide hole 9, and the telescopic end of the au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 slides in the guide hole 9.

[0034] In this embodiment, an inclined guide plate 8 is provided on the side frame 2, and a guide hole 9 is opened on the guide plate 8. The telescopic end of the au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4 is inserted into the guide hole 9, which can limit its telescopic direction and ensure that the telescopic direction does not deviate. At the same time, the guide hole 9 can share the weight of the telescopic end of the auxiliary telescopic cylinder 4, and avoid it from being damaged due to excessive force.

[0035] It also includes a clamping rod 10 and a clamping plate 11. The middle part of the clamping rod 10 is swung on the frame 1, and the clamping plate 11 is located on the top of the clamping rod 10. The clamping rod 10 and the clamping plate 11 are arranged in pairs and are located on both sides of the workpiece respectively.

[0036] It also includes a clamping telescopic cylinder 12, the two ends of which are respectively hinged to the bottom of the two clamping rods 10.

[0037] The clamping rod 10, the workpiece, and the horizontal plane form a triangle.

[0038] In this embodiment, to further improve the stability of the welding frame, a clamping rod 10 is oscillatingly mounted on the frame 1. The clamping rod 10 is located at the lower part of the frame, with its middle section hinged to the frame 1 and a clamping plate 11 at its top. The two clamping rods 10 oscillate synchronously to clamp the frame. To achieve synchronous oscillation of the two clamping rods 10, a clamping telescopic cylinder 12 is also provided. The two ends of the clamping telescopic cylinder 12 are respectively hinged to the bottom of the two clamping rods 10, and can drive the oscillation of the clamping rods 10 after extension and retraction. In addition, when the frame is clamped, the clamping rod 10 forms an angle with the horizontal plane. At this time, the clamping rod 10, the frame, and the ground form a triangular structure, thereby improving the stability of the structure.

[0039] It also includes a guardrail 13, which is located at the top edge of the side frame 2 to prevent workers from falling.

[0040] In this embodiment, during operation, the staff needs to work on the top of the side frame 2 and perform operations such as swinging the counterweight bar. Because the frame size is large, the top of the side frame 2 is high above the ground, which poses a certain safety hazard. Therefore, a guardrail 13 is installed on the edge of the top of the side frame 2 to effectively prevent the staff from falling and improve safety.
